
要对自定义类型的切片进行排序,需要实现 sort.Interface 接口。 Go Web服务器在处理HTTP请求路由时,遇到一个因正则表达式语法误用导致的匹配异常。 anchorTag.title = "Dottoro 帮助页面";: 设置书签的标题。 这意味着,如果你在 PHP CS Fixer...

实际上,这种方式并非Go语言推荐的标准实践。 这个方法在需要实现 >= 或 <= 等逻辑时非常有用,例如 if v1.Compare(v2) >= 0。 在Go语言中,测试数据的初始化与清理是编写可靠单元测试和集成测试的关键环节。 基本上就这些,不复杂但容易忽略细节,比如路径处理、...

同时,务必注意内容的安全转义,以防范潜在的XSS漏洞。 一旦找到满足条件的值,即可停止遍历。 定期清理: 如果无法实时标准化,可以考虑通过定时任务批量清理和更新现有数据。 chmod 755 ~/tmp 如果你的系统管理员对 /tmp 目录进行了特殊的安全配置,那么即使使用 root 用户也可能无法...

集成到Go项目: 将获取到的losetup.c文件(或其关键函数)复制到你的Go项目目录中。 理解其工作原理,有助于编写高效且正确的并发程序。 仅在格式固定、需求简单的场景下(如提取日志中的特定XML片段)可临时使用正则快速获取信息。 第三方库:如 github.com/mohae/deepcopy...

保持一致性:如果一个类型有的方法使用指针接收者,建议其他方法也使用指针接收者,避免混用造成 confusion。 建议使用有效证书如Let's Encrypt,避免InsecureSkipVerify,必要时在应用层叠加AES等加密,实现双重保护,并定期更新密钥证书以保障安全。 合理使用模板特化,处...

这取决于导入和执行的顺序,非常容易出错。 例如:type Account struct { // 组1: 基础信息,不常变更 ID string Name string Email string CreatedAt time.Time // 组2: 动态信息,频繁变更 LastLogin time....

关键在于合理设计服务端架构、优化资源调度,并减少瓶颈环节。 注意事项: 这种方法简单直接,但可能会导致script1.py在被其他模块导入时,意外地启动进程。 将这些指令直接打包传输到另一个可能拥有不同CPU架构、操作系统或内存地址空间的机器上,并期望它们能无缝执行,几乎是不可能的。 更重要的是,填...

[@Name="Pass"]: 进一步筛选出Name属性值为Pass的Option元素。 编程最佳实践与注意事项 除了上述核心解决方案,还有一些编程最佳实践可以进一步提升代码的健壮性和可读性。 示例:简单的向量化操作 考虑一个简单的例子,为DataFrame添加一个新列,该列是现有列加1的结果:im...

立即学习“PHP免费学习笔记(深入)”; 常见表现: 翻到后面几页响应明显变慢 服务器CPU或I/O占用升高 查询执行时间随页码增大而线性增长 高效分页优化技巧 为解决大数据分页性能问题,可采用以下方法: 1. 基于游标的分页(推荐)用上一页最后一条记录的主键或排序字段作为下一页的起点,避免OFFS...

当Pandas DataFrame列中混合了整数和None值时,默认行为会将整列转换为浮点类型,并将None替换为NaN。 在使用 Laravel 开发实时应用时,核心通信机制依赖于事件广播(Event Broadcasting)和 WebSocket 技术。 27 查看详情 int rows = ...